项目摘要

Recent work by the applicant has been concerned with dealing with some of the performance and QoS (quality of service) issues which exist in current Internet, particularly for inelastic applications that are sensitive to delay and packet loss. The current Internet was originally designed to support flat, elastic, applications which are relatively insensitive to delay and where packet losses could be handled by retransmissions. Modern applications, such as video streaming and collaborative work require timely delivery and a QoS assurance level. Long propagation delays, by itself, makes retransmission infeasible in many cases and forwarding delays due to congestion and poor routing compound the problem Furthermore, services on the current Internet are network centric, whereas modern needs are more user/application centric. Thus, in recent years the applicant has done work on web caching, load sensitive dynamic routing, multicasting, discard policies for QoS maintenance in transport of MPEG streams, routing improvement in DHT-based P2P networks, simulation tools for large scale networks, route failure recovery for reserved routing.
